Commercial Flights to Shift to Alluri Sitarama Raju International Airport from August 17

Commercial flight operations will officially shift from Visakhapatnam Airport to the newly developed Alluri Sitarama Raju International Airport in Bhogapuram from August 17, marking a major milestone in Andhra Pradesh's aviation infrastructure.

According to a notification issued by the Ministry of Civil Aviation, all commercial services operating from the Civil Enclave at Visakhapatnam Airport (INS Dega) will cease from 00:01 hours on August 17, with operations moving to the new airport in Vizianagaram district.

The transition follows the inauguration of the airport by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on August 1. Developed at an investment of nearly Rs 4,727 crore, the Greenfield airport has been completed in just 31 months, nearly five months ahead of schedule, making it one of the fastest-completed international Greenfield airports in the country.

The Ministry also announced that the International Air Transport Association (IATA) airport code "VTZ", currently used by Visakhapatnam Airport, will be transferred to the new airport from 00:01 hours on August 17. Additionally, the Bhogapuram Greenfield Airport has officially been renamed Alluri Sitarama Raju International Airport with immediate effect.

While commercial flight operations will move entirely to the new airport, the Civil Enclave at Visakhapatnam Airport will remain reserved for national emergencies and aircraft operated by the Indian Air Force, other Armed Forces, police authorities, and special government-owned, leased, or hired VIP aircraft.

The airport has already received its DGCA aerodrome licence, along with all mandatory safety, fire, and environmental clearances, and is ready to begin commercial operations.

In its first phase, the airport has been designed to handle 6 million passengers annually, with a long-term master plan to expand its capacity to 40 million passengers per year.

Spread across 2,703.26 acres, the integrated project includes 2,203.32 acres for the airport, 500 acres for an aviation hub, and 136.63 acres earmarked for an Aviation University and EduCity. The development also features commercial spaces, residential zones, approach roads, and supporting infrastructure.

The airport's 3,800-metre Code-E runway is capable of accommodating wide-body aircraft, including the Boeing 777, Boeing 787 Dreamliner, Airbus A330, and Airbus A340. It is equipped with advanced airfield lighting, navigation systems, and CNS/ATM infrastructure to support both domestic and international operations.

Passengers will also benefit from modern terminal facilities such as contact boarding bridges, Common Use Passenger Processing System (CUPPS), self-baggage drop, self-service passenger processing, smart surveillance, integrated security systems, and an Integrated Operational Control and Monitoring Centre.

The new airport is expected to play a significant role in strengthening tourism, trade, exports, logistics, industrial investment, and the aerospace and defence sectors across the erstwhile Visakhapatnam, Vizianagaram, and Srikakulam districts, while enhancing Andhra Pradesh's overall air connectivity.
